Baylor graduates Chris and Nate Naramor, Pepperdine graduate Matt Naramor and their father, Dan, prove that success can run in the family. Their company, Graslon, manufactures and sells unique and innovative camera accessories in Chino, Calif.

Baylor defeated Oklahoma State 45-27 Saturday to improve to 3-2 this season. The Cowboys’ 27 points scored marked their best offensive performance against an FBS team this year, more than doubling last week’s 12-point showing against Tulsa.
